Irvine bmw mini dealer Source Source Source Source Source Source Source Read Also: Harry fairbairn irvine bmw co uk Bmw irvine mini Irvine bmw mini service Irvine bmw mini cooper Bmw harry fairbairn irvine Bmw mini irvine ca